Output af33ebd2de5ac7057f2d03fbda3a1eef031be80e8b92b8b777f7c79585dc905c:29

value
26000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612827025e6427677f5ea83faa4f3eb78625ec39 OP_EQUAL
address
3AYjZzES9ivpFvEVzkThP9XcMewK6K28wy
transaction
af33ebd2de5ac7057f2d03fbda3a1eef031be80e8b92b8b777f7c79585dc905c